Product Description:
The AX52XX-FP00.7 is a dual-axis servo drive from Beckhoff within the AX Digital Servo Drives series. In multi-motor machinery, it converts DC bus power into controlled AC for two synchronous or induction motors, allowing position and velocity loops to close directly inside the control cabinet. It also combines braking energy handling with configurable I/O for coordinated motion tasks in packaging, handling, and general automation cells.
The drive offers a configurable output current of 0.5 A per digital output, which is sufficient for solenoid valves or opto-isolated relays tied to the controller. It has 8 on-board digital inputs for fast trigger capture, and those channels are scanned at drive cycle speed. A DC link rated for up to 875 VDC lets the unit share energy with other modules on a common bus, while integrated capacitors absorb transients. Two independent inverter stages provide 2 motor channels, so a single module can command a pair of axes without additional hardware. Regenerative heat created during rapid deceleration is dissipated inside the housing, and the allowable internal brake power reaches 14 kW when no external resistor is connected. The unit also uses single-phase power entry, provides a sensor supply current of 1 A, and has a depth of 232 mm.
For applications that need higher braking capacity, an external brake resistor can be fitted, and the module permits up to 15 kW of brake energy when that resistor is present, provided its resistance is no lower than 47 Ω. The housing is rated IP20, so the drive must be installed in a protected cabinet, and its 92 mm width with a 317.70 mm height allows side-by-side mounting. Short-circuit withstand capability on the mains side is rated at 18 kA SCCR. One configurable transistor output is available for status or interlock signaling.
